dilettante \DIL-uh-tahnt; dil-uh-TAHNT; dil-uh-TAHN-tee; -TANT; TAN-tee\, noun; :
dilettantes, also dilettanti \-TAHN-tee; -TAN-\; plural
dilettante, dilettantish; adjective
dilettantism; noun

1. An admirer or lover of the fine arts.
2. An amateur; especially, one who follows an art or a branch of knowledge sporadically, superficially, or for amusement only.
3. Of or characteristic of a dilettante; amateurish
4. An admirer or lover of the fine arts; popularly, an amateur; especially, one who follows an art or a branch of knowledge, desultorily, or for amusement only.

At first his colleagues tended to dismiss this witty young dilettante poet as a scientific lightweight, even if he was an agreeable addition to their dinner table.
--"Dr Alex Comfort," Times (London), March 28, 2000

Etymology: Italian, from present participle of dilettare to delight, from Latin dilectare. Date: 1748
